"Eleven Arhats" is the first in this series, witty and ingenious. Ocean played by George Clooney is the protagonist, and the theme of the film is to help him repay his wife's hatred. But Rusty played by Brad Pitt is the core. He finds almost all the members. He coordinates everyone and directs all actions, but he does not steal the limelight, but is a part of the entire team, like a hinge. All the gears are linked together, and he is indispensable for not stealing the spotlight. The eleven arhats with different personalities formed a complete team, each of them exerted their strengths and worked together to complete an almost impossible task. It feels so good.
